Transaction 743f48ba553775e74058d5759f4f1618d73b8c8f2b6a1754a698707d946faf8d

1 Input
2 Outputs
  • 743f48ba553775e74058d5759f4f1618d73b8c8f2b6a1754a698707d946faf8d:0
  • value  2559665
    address  3K848WDVviYhW85M2uXwnGJqzBQ7JJjqMy
  • 743f48ba553775e74058d5759f4f1618d73b8c8f2b6a1754a698707d946faf8d:1
  • value  144128284966
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g